VICTORIAN 2 PIECE AFTERNOON VISITING DRESS 1893

A 1900s brown wool with red and white thin stripes woven into the fabric, 2 piece in construction dress that a clerk in a store or teacher would wear.

The bodice is decorated with standup collar with white braided cording on collar and cuffs. With vertical pleating on either side of front closure and adorned with a red velvet insert and red velvet covered buttons on cuffs and back split tail. Bodice is lined with a brown cotton and with no inner stays and has a front hook and eye center closures.

The skirt has a full back sweep with large pleating at back and gathered for a nice full fall, and lined with a two different printed patterned full length cotton lining. Adorned with hand embroidered red leaves at center front of skirt.
